The Cola Plant, scientifically known as Cola acuminata, is an evergreen tree native to the tropical rainforests of West Africa. It typically grows to a height of 40–60 feet, with a dense canopy of glossy, dark green leaves. Thriving in USDA hardiness zones 10–12, the Cola Plant prefers warm, humid climates with well-draining soil and consistent moisture. Its attractive foliage and ornamental growth make it a stunning addition to large gardens or tropical landscapes. The plant produces striking red or orange flowers, followed by kola nuts, which are culturally and economically significant in its native regions.
Cola nuts harvested from Cola acuminata are prized for their natural caffeine content and have historically been used in traditional medicine, social rituals, and as a flavoring in beverages. Beyond their cultural importance, the seeds serve as a natural stimulant and are sometimes incorporated into modern energy drinks and herbal remedies. Additionally, the Cola Plant contributes to biodiversity, providing food and shelter for various wildlife species. With its unique combination of aesthetic appeal and practical uses, the Cola Plant is both a decorative and functional treasure in tropical horticulture.
